Windshields are made of two layers of glass and, if damage penetrates through to the plastic layer or the inner layer of glass, it can’t be repaired and will have to be replaced .

Can you fix a crack in a car windshield?

Whether it’s two or 10 inches long, or somewhere in between, a crack has always been a primary reason to get a windshield replaced. Cracks, both short and long, can be repaired by filling the damage with a special resin .

Can you fix a cracked windshield without replacing it?

A repair is a cost-effective solution to keep the crack or chip from spreading while hiding the original damage. The industry standard is that if a windshield crack can be covered with a dollar bill, or measures less than 3 inches, it’s possible to simply repair the windshield without having to replace it entirely .

How big can a crack in a windshield be to repair?

Pretty much any shop should be able to repair chips of about one-inch diameter and cracks about three inches long . Traditionally, any crack larger than a dollar bill could not be repaired, so size was a very important factor in making the determination.

What happens if you don’t fix a cracked windshield?

Damaged Windshields are Not Safe

If the glass has cracks, chips, or missing pieces, then the odds are against you that the entire windshield will stay intact in a collision . Your best bet is to fix the windshield imperfections as they happen, and restore windshield’s stability.

What causes windshield to crack?

By far, the most common cause of front windshield damage comes from rocks and gravel thrown up from the road surface by other vehicles’ tires . They gain surprising velocity and hit with enough force that they can break or chip your glass instantly.

How do you fix a cracked windshield at home?

  1. Buy a windshield repair kit.
  2. Clean the glass around chip or crack.
  3. Apply the adhesive patch and plastic pedestal that comes with the kit.
  4. Inject the kit’s epoxy resin with the syringe.
  5. Allow it to cure and remove the pedestal.

Does insurance cover windshield crack?

In most cases, your insurance provider will pay for the cost of chips or cracks in your windshield if you have comprehensive coverage . You may not even have to pay the deductible in such cases because it’s cheaper for the insurance company to pay for the damage now before it becomes a bigger problem later.

Is driving with a cracked windshield illegal?

Driving with a cracked windscreen can be considered a motoring offence . It could constitute use of a motor vehicle in a dangerous condition. The Highway Code states that drivers should have a full view of the road ahead and glass should be maintained in a good condition.

Do windshield cracks grow?

If you have cracks and chips and it gets hot outside, the glass will expand and that could cause the chips or cracks to also expand and grow . When chips and cracks grow they may become unrepairable and you may wind up needing a total windshield replacement.

Who pays when a rock hits your windshield?

If a rock flies directly from the back of a track and hits your windshield, the company may be responsible for the damage . They can be found liable if you stayed 100 to 150 feet away from the truck and/or if you can show that the truck was overloaded and carrying more rock or gravel than they should have been.

Can heat crack a windshield?

The sun and heat can both cause your glass to heat up and expand, which can cause the crack or chip to rapidly spread . If this happens, the crack or chip can become too large to repair and your entire windshield will need to be replaced.

Will defrost crack my windshield?

The cold weather will quickly cool the windshield’s surface temperature. Then, when you switch on the defroster to clear the windshield before you drive to work or you park the car in the sunlight, the uneven heating of the window adds stress to the weak spot which can rapidly turn into that dreaded crack.
